## How much does residential parking cost in suburban Long Island ZIP codes?

Residential parking in suburban Long Island usually costs **$0 to $300 per year** for a town or village permit, or **$50 to $300 per month** for a rented private space. In higher-demand areas, gated or reserved parking can cost even more.

Here’s what you need to know:

| Parking type | Typical cost |
|---|---|
| Street parking permit | $0 to $300 per year |
| Reserved residential lot space | $50 to $300 per month |
| Private driveway or garage rental | $100 to $400 per month |
| Premium or guarded parking | $300+ per month |

Costs change a lot by town, block, and property type. In ZIP code 11507 and nearby suburban Long Island areas, many homes include driveway parking, so the cost may be **$0** if parking comes with the property. If a home does not have off-street parking, the price depends on local permit rules and private lot availability.

A few things usually affect the price:

- **Town rules:** Some villages charge for parking permits, while others keep resident street parking free.
- **Space type:** A driveway spot usually costs less than a covered garage or secured lot.
- **Demand:** Areas near train stations, downtown strips, and apartment clusters often cost more.
- **Season and enforcement:** Winter rules, overnight restrictions, and guest permit limits can change the real cost.

If you rent in suburban Long Island, ask three questions before you sign:

1. Does the rent include parking?
2. Is parking assigned, shared, or first come, first served?
3. Are there extra monthly or yearly permit fees?

If you own a home, check whether the property has legal off-street parking. If it does not, you may need a municipal permit or a private spot nearby. That can turn a free parking setup into a recurring cost.

For most drivers, the safest planning range is **$0 to $300 per year** if parking is included with housing, or **$100 to $400 per month** if you need to rent space separately. The exact price in 11507 depends on the town, the street, and how close you are to busy areas.
